JEE Main Chemistry Exam Pattern 2026
Understanding the exam pattern is the first step towards effective preparation. The National Testing Agency (NTA) has released the JEE Main 2026 exam pattern which remains consistent with previous years.
Parameter
Details
Total Questions
25 questions (20 MCQs + 5 Numerical Value Questions)
Total Marks
100 marks
Time Allotted
Part of 3-hour paper (recommended 45-50 minutes)
Section A (MCQs)
20 questions × 4 marks = 80 marks
Section B (Numerical)
5 questions × 4 marks = 20 marks (All compulsory)
Marking Scheme
+4 for correct, -1 for wrong (MCQs), No negative marking for numerical
Mode of Exam
Computer Based Test (CBT)
Language Options
13 languages including English, Hindi, and regional languages

Deleted Topics from JEE Main Chemistry Syllabus 2026
NTA removed several topics from the Chemistry syllabus in 2024. These deletions remain applicable for JEE Main 2026. Students should avoid studying these chapters as no questions will appear from them.
Section
Deleted Topics/Chapters
Physical Chemistry
Solid State, States of Matter (Gaseous State), Surface Chemistry
Inorganic Chemistry
General Principles and Processes of Isolation of Metals, s-Block Elements, Hydrogen, Environmental Chemistry
Organic Chemistry
Alcohols, Phenols and Ethers (partially reduced), Polymers
JEE Main Chemistry Topic-Wise Weightage 2026
Based on analysis of previous year papers, certain chapters consistently carry higher weightage. Focusing on high-weightage topics can help maximize scores with efficient preparation.
Chapter
Expected Questions
Weightage (%)
Coordination Compounds
3-4
12-16%
Chemical Bonding
2-3
8-12%
Aldehydes, Ketones and Carboxylic Acids
2-3
8-12%
Thermodynamics
2-3
8-12%
Organic Chemistry (GOC + IUPAC)
2-3
8-12%
Electrochemistry
2
8%
Chemical Kinetics
1-2
4-8%
Equilibrium
1-2
4-8%
d-Block and f-Block Elements
1-2
4-8%
p-Block Elements
1-2
4-8%
Solutions
1-2
4-8%
Biomolecules
1
4%

JEE Main Chemistry Preparation Strategy 2026
A strategic approach combining conceptual clarity, regular practice, and smart revision is essential for scoring high in Chemistry. The section rewards students who balance theory with problem-solving.
Step 1: Build Strong Foundation with NCERT
Start with NCERT textbooks for Class 11 and 12. Read every line carefully, especially for Inorganic Chemistry where questions come directly from NCERT. Highlight key reactions, properties, and exceptions. Complete all intext examples and exercises before moving to reference books.
Step 2: Section-Wise Approach
Allocate your time wisely across sections. Spend approximately 40% on Physical Chemistry, 30% on Organic Chemistry, and 30% on Inorganic Chemistry. Adjust based on your strengths and weaknesses.
Step 3: Practice Regularly
Solve chapter-wise MCQs after completing each topic. Practice previous year questions (PYQs) from 2020-2025 to understand patterns. Attempt 20-30 questions daily from different topics.
Step 4: Maintain Formula and Reaction Sheets
Create separate notebooks for Physical Chemistry formulas and Organic Chemistry reactions. Revise these sheets daily for 20-30 minutes. Include important exceptions and trends for Inorganic Chemistry.
JEE Main Chemistry Preparation: Section-Wise Tips
Physical Chemistry Preparation
Focus on understanding concepts rather than memorizing formulas. Derive formulas where possible.
Practice numericals daily. Start with basic problems and gradually increase difficulty.
Master Mole Concept first as it forms the foundation for all other chapters.
Create a formula sheet and revise it regularly. Include unit conversions.
Solve numerical problems from Chemical Kinetics, Electrochemistry, and Thermodynamics extensively.
Use P. Bahadur or N. Awasthi for advanced numerical practice after completing NCERT.
Organic Chemistry Preparation
Follow a sequential study order: GOC → IUPAC → Hydrocarbons → Haloalkanes → Alcohols → Aldehydes → Amines.
Understand reaction mechanisms rather than just memorizing products. Know the "why" behind every reaction.
Make flowcharts connecting different reactions and functional group interconversions.
Practice named reactions with reagents, conditions, and products. Create a list of 30-40 important named reactions.
Solve practice problems from M.S. Chauhan after completing NCERT examples.
Focus on GOC as it appears in almost every Organic Chemistry question directly or indirectly.
Inorganic Chemistry Preparation
NCERT is 100% sufficient for Inorganic Chemistry. Read it line by line multiple times.
Create summary notes for each element covering preparation, properties, compounds, and uses.
Use mnemonics for remembering periodic trends, colors, and exceptions.
Focus on Coordination Compounds as it carries the highest weightage (3-4 questions).
Memorize important reactions, colors of compounds, and geometries thoroughly.
Revise Inorganic Chemistry frequently as it is memory-based and tends to fade without revision.

Exam Day Tips for Chemistry
Attempt Chemistry first if it is your strong subject to build confidence
Allocate 45-50 minutes maximum for Chemistry section
Attempt Inorganic Chemistry questions first as they are quickest to solve
Leave time-consuming numerical problems for the end
Mark doubtful questions for review and move forward
Avoid spending more than 2 minutes on any single question
